Common questions

Is magnetic phone umbrella profitable to sell on Amazon United States?
The niche generates $8K/yr across 15 tracked products. 3 of 4 products launched in the last 360 days are still selling. 90-day search growth is +468.6%. Flapen's verdict: Worth a look (50/100).
How competitive is the magnetic phone umbrella niche?
10 brands and 13 sellers compete. The top 5 products take 64% of clicks and top 5 brands hold 86% of demand.
What do buyers complain about in magnetic phone umbrella?
Top complaints mined from reviews: Magnetic Strength/Adsorption, Functionality-Overall, Durability. The return rate is 3.2%.
When does demand for magnetic phone umbrella peak?
Demand peaks in May–Jun–Jul; the busiest month runs 39.5× the quietest.
What does it cost to enter the magnetic phone umbrella niche?
Listings span $8.84–$15.99; the average listing price is $13.65 (sweet spot $15–$100). The average incumbent carries 322 reviews — the moat a new listing must climb.
